bl双性强迫侵犯h_国产在线观看人成激情视频_蜜芽188_被诱拐的少孩全彩啪啪漫画

如何防止php相同數據 如何防止php相同數據合并

php中mysql如何避免輸入相同數據

你這是PHP語法錯誤引起的。我想你沒認真看過PHP手冊吧。

創新互聯長期為上千家客戶提供的網站建設服務,團隊從業經驗10年,關注不同地域、不同群體,并針對不同對象提供差異化的產品和服務;打造開放共贏平臺,與合作伙伴共同營造健康的互聯網生態環境。為長垣企業提供專業的網站設計、做網站,長垣網站改版等技術服務。擁有十年豐富建站經驗和眾多成功案例,為您定制開發。

"SELECT * FROM users where UserName=’{$_POST['username']}‘"

有什么問題,錯誤提示是什么,你要貼出來啊!

PHP 怎么防止GET方式提交重復數據?

PHP 防止表單重復提交,使用令牌來做驗證,即可解決。示例如下:

index.php:

?php?

header("Content-type:text/html;charset=utf-8");

//開啟session

session_start();

//如果令牌為空,則生成一個令牌

if(!isset($_SESSION['token']?)????||?$_SESSION['token']?==?""){

//給當前表單生成一個令牌

$_SESSION['token']?=?md5(microtime(true));

}

?

form?method="get"?action="deal.php"

名稱:?input?type="text"?name="names"br/

描述:?input?type="text"?name="desc"br/

input?type="text"?name="token"?value="?=$_SESSION['token']?"

input?type="submit"?value="提交"

/form

deal.php:

?php

header("Content-type:text/html;charset=utf-8");

//開啟session

session_start();

//驗證令牌

if($_REQUEST['token']?===?$_SESSION['token']){

//表單已經提交,重新生成令牌

$_SESSION['token']?=?md5(microtime(true));

echo?"表單提交成功:br/";

print_r($_REQUEST);

}else{

echo?"重復提交";

}

?

php 如何避免刷新頁面重復插入數據到數據庫

每次進入提交的頁面,給一個session,為了避免重復,session的key可以是隨機的。

在表單填寫頁面

?php

session_start(); // 啟用session

$time = time();

$key = 'sess_' . $time; // 根據時間生成一個隨機的session key

$_SESSION[$key] = $time; // 設置session的值

?

!--{通過隱藏表單將 session 的 key傳遞到服務端處理}--

input type="hidden" name="session_key" value="?php echo $time;?" /

處理頁面

?php

session_start(); // 啟用session

$key = $_POST['session_key'];

if(!$key || $_SESSION[$key] != substr($key, 5)){

// 如果沒有傳 session_key 參數

// 或者 session_key 參數值截斷 sess_后的數字 與 session參數值不匹配

unset($_SESSION[$key]); // 刪除 session 值

// 然后考慮是否要提示錯誤,或者轉入另一個頁面

exit(); // 終止頁面代碼執行

}

// 下面進行數據寫操作

// 數據操作完成后,刪除session

unset($_SESSION[$key]);

// 后續操作

?

$########################

一個頁面也是一樣的,我給你的只是一個思維,

具體如何實現,你要根據自己的實際情況去處理

很多東西都不是通用的

另外,不管多少個頁面,必然包含兩個部分,一部分是表單填寫,一部分是數據處理,這個跟多少個頁面無關~~就看你是否能夠理解這段代碼的意義,如果不理解的話,嵌套進去也沒啥用,能夠理解的話,或許你能夠找出更適合自己的解決方案

thinkphp 防止重復提交數據。

親,你可以加驗證碼驗證啊!~~

第一次產生驗證碼,然后驗證完成后就將驗證碼更新掉,這樣他再提交驗證碼就錯誤了,驗證碼錯誤就不讓他提交,直接轉向就好了!~~

驗證碼是防止重復提交的一個簡單的方式,目前還是比較有效的!~~

而且tp生成驗證碼很簡單,驗證也很方便的!~~

具體可以參考文檔這里:

希望對你有幫助,如果有幫助,記得采納喲!~~

新聞標題:如何防止php相同數據 如何防止php相同數據合并
標題路徑:http://vcdvsql.cn/article18/doicsdp.html

成都網站建設公司_創新互聯,為您提供Google面包屑導航網站設計公司軟件開發動態網站品牌網站制作

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

外貿網站建設